Events Volunteers
The FoPP get involved in all types of events and projects, both at Pickerings Pasture and Hale Duck Decoy.
- They ran a Fun Dog Show for four consecutive years, raising funds for their winter bird feeding stations.
- With the Ranger, they planned and organised a Country Fayre funded by an Awards For All grant.
- They developed the Gamekeepers Cottage, at Hale Duck Decoy, and historical information relating to the site, with a Lottery Heritage Initiative Grant.
- They organised a Memories Event at the Visitors Centre, related to the Gamekeepers Cottage Project.
- They have helped build, repair and put up bird boxes at Pickerings Pasture and the Decoy.
- They have helped to plant hundreds of trees and bulbs.
- They help maintain the hides and the area around them at Pickerings Pasture and the Decoy.
- They helped design and build a new hide at Hale Duck Decoy: the Tom Johnston hide.
- They have funded, sort and gained sponsorship for, and maintained, regular bird feeding at Pickerings Pasture and Hale Duck Decoy.
- They have been regularly involved in clearing, cutting back, tyding up and painting activities at both Pickerings Pasture and the Decoy.
- They were involved in gaining sponsorship and planning for the new Pickerings pathway, along the river side.
- They have actively supported many HBC events at Pickerings Pasture and guided walks at Hale Duck Decoy.
